This release presents the complete original classic album Black, Brown and Beige with Mahalia Jackson's poignant voice backed by the Ellington orchestra. As a bonus, three vocal related Ellington works: the suite "Portrait of Ella Fitzgerald" * Duke and Billy Strayhorn' s dedication to the famous singer - and the only two vocal arrangements from the album Masterpieces by Ellington.
DUKE ELLINGTON and His Orchestra:
Cat Anderson, Harold "Shorty" Baker, Clark Terry (tp), Ray Nance (tp & vln), Quentin Jackson, Britt Woodman (tb), John Sanders (v-tb), Jimmy Hamilton (el), Russell Procope (as, el), Bill Graham (as), Paul Gonsalves (ts), Harry Carney (bs, b-cl, el), Duke Ellington (p), Jimmy Woode (b), Sam Woodyard (d). Los Angeles, February 1958.
BONUS TRACKS: (7): Duke Ellington and His Orchestra: Chicago, September 2-3, 1957. (8-9): Duke Ellington and His Orchestra. Yvonne Lanauze (vcl). New York, December 19, 1950.

"What Ellington and Mahalia have done is created a gentle, reverent, powerful prayer. There is nothing else I can write to describe or interpret this album. I was moved by it through more than six playings. I think it's the best work Duke's band has done in years. I think, too, that Mahalia's presence was a stimulus to the performance which makes this more than another Ellington LP, but rather an Ellington milestone." Dom Cerulli
